What's the point of watching a film? over 2 years ago

“Our taverns and our metropolitan streets, our offices and furnished rooms, our railroad stations and our factories appeared to have us locked up hopelessly. Then came the film and burst this prison-world asunder by the dynamite of the tenth of a second, so that now, in the midst of its far-flung ruins and debris, we calmly and adventurously go traveling.”
Walter Benjamin ‘The Work of Art in the Age of Mechanical Reproduction’
